The morality of compromise' sounds contradictory.Compromise is usually a sign of weakness, or an admission of defeat.Strong men don't compromise, it is said, and principles should never be compromised.I shall argue that strong men, conversely, know when to compromise and that all principles can be compromised to serve a greater principle.
- Handy, Charles
Business Motivational Quotes



Best Quotes about Business

1.
Corporation. An ingenious device for obtaining individual profit without individual responsibility.
Bierce, Ambrose

2.
It's far better to buy a wonderful company at a fair price than a fair company at a wonderful price.
Buffett, Warren

3.
If you have lower than a ten percent turnover, there is a problem. And if you have higher than, say 20%, there is a problem.
Mcgovern, William

4.
It's the economy, stupid.
Clinton, Bill

5.
Business, more than any other occupation, is a continual dealing with the future; it is a continual calculation, an instinctive exercise in foresight.
Luce, Henry

6.
If you don't drive your business you will be driven out of business.
Forbes, B. C.

7.
I do not believe a man can ever leave his business. He ought to think of it by day and dream of it by night.
Ford, Henry

8.
In business for yourself, not by yourself.
Kroc, Ray

9.
Executives are like joggers. If you stop a jogger, he goes on running on the spot. If you drag an executive away from his business, he goes on running on the spot, pawing the ground, talking business. He never stops hurtling onwards, making decisions and executing them.
Baudrillard, Jean

10.
Don't forget until too late that the business of life is not business, but living.
Forbes, B. C.

11.
Our planning system was dynamite when we first put it in. The thinking was fresh; the form mattered little. It was idea oriented. We then hired a head of planning, and he hired two vice presidents, and then he hired a planner; and the books got thicker, and the printing more sophisticated, and the covers got harder, and the drawings got better.
Welch, John

12.
A man with a surplus can control circumstances, but a man without a surplus is controlled by them, and often has no opportunity to exercise judgment.
Firestone, Harvey S.

13.
If your advertising goes unnoticed, everything else is academic!
Bernbach, William

14.
Conducting your business in a socially responsible way is good business. It means that you can attract better employees and that customers will know what you stand for and like you for it.
Burns, M. Anthony

15.
The big will get bigger; the small will get wiped out.
Riklis, Meshulam

16.
Business, that's easily defined; it's other people's money.
Dumas, Alexandre

17.
The purpose of business is to create and keep a customer.
Leavitt, Theodore

18.
The happiest time in a man's life is when he is in the red hot pursuit of a dollar with a reasonable prospect of overtaking it.
Billings, Josh

19.
As a small businessperson, you have no greater leverage than the truth.
Hawken, Paul

20.
You can close more business in two months by becoming interested in other people than you can in two years by trying to get people interested in you.
Carnegie, Dale

21.
Goodwill is the one and only asset that competition cannot undersell or destroy.
Field, Marshall

22.
Good design can't fix broken business models.
Jeffrey Veen

23.
Location, location, location.
Dillard, William

24.
It's better to take over and build upon an existing business than to start a new one.
Geneen, Harold S.

25.
Do not fear mistakes. You will know failure. Continue to reach out.
Galvin, Robert

26.
Blessed is he who talks in circles, for he shall become a big wheel.
Dane, Frank

27.
Anything that you do to increase job security automatically does work for you. It makes your employees a closer part of the unit.
Smith, Roger

28.
Drive your business, let not your business drive you.
Franklin, Benjamin

29.
You can employ men and hire hands to work for you, but you must win their hearts to have them work with you.
Riorio

30.
If a business does well, the stock eventually follows.
Buffett, Warren

31.
You don't want to get the same kind of advice from everyone on your board.
Cardenas, Ruben

32.
Business is more exciting than any game.
Beaverbrook, Lord

33.
Women do not win formula one races, because they simply are not strong enough to resist the G-forces.In the boardroom, it is different.I believe women are better able to marshal their thoughts than men and because they are less egotistical they make fewer assumptions.
Foulston, Nicola

34.
Deals are my art form. Other people paint beautifully on canvas or write wonderful poetry. I like making deals, preferably big deals. That's how I get my kicks.
Trump, Donald

35.
Letting your customers set your standards is a dangerous game, because the race to the bottom is pretty easy to win. Setting your own standards--and living up to them--is a better way to profit. Not to mention a better way to make your day worth all the effort you put into it.
Seth Godin

36.
If we decide to take this level of business creating ability nationwide, we'll all be plucking chickens for a living.
Perot, H. Ross

37.
A vacation should be just long enough that you're boss misses you, and not long enough for him to discover how well he can get along without you.

38.
Entrepreneurship is the last refuge of the trouble making individual.
Cooley, Mason

39.
You generally hear that what a man doesn't know doesn't hurt him, but in business what a man doesn't know does hurt.
Lewis, E. St. Elmo

40.
Cut your losses and let your profits run.
Proverb, American

41.
If you don't do it with excellence, don't do it at all! Because if it's not excellent, it won't be profitable or fun, and if you're not in business for fun or profit, what the hell are you doing there?
Townsend, Robert

42.
Such is the brutalization of commercial ethics in this country that no one can feel anything more delicate than the velvet touch of a soft buck.
Chandler, Raymond

43.
Entrepreneurs are simply those who understand that there is little difference between obstacle and opportunity and are able to turn both to their advantage.
Kiam, Victor

44.
You can't run a business without taking risks.
Drexler, Millard

45.
HereÆs my theory about meetings and life; the three things you canÆt fake are erections, competence and creativity. ThatÆs why meetings become toxic they put uncreative people in a situation in which they have to be something they can never be. And the more effort they put into concealing their inabilities, the more toxic the meeting becomes. One of the most common creativity-faking tactics is when someone puts their hands in prayer position and conceals their mouth while they nod at you and say,'Mmmmmm. Interesting.'If pressed, theyÆll add,'IÆll have to get back to you on that.'Then they donÆt say anything else.
Douglas Coupland

46.
Treat employees like partners, and they act like partners.
Allen, Fred A.

47.
The business that considers itself immune to the necessity for advertising sooner or later finds itself immune to business.
Brown, Derby

48.
We are all manufacturers. Making good, making trouble, or making excuses.
Adolt, H. V.

49.
The purpose of a business is to create a customer.
Drucker, Peter F.

50.
Business is like a wheelbarrow--it stands still until someone pushes it.
